Why These Are the Top Chevrolet Repair Auto Repair Shops in Gate

** The Chevrolet repair market serving Gate, Oklahoma, is characteristic of a rural Great Plains region. There are no dealership service centers within a close radius, making independent shops and local garages the primary service providers. The market is not highly saturated with specialists, but the existing providers have established strong reputations for reliability and broad technical knowledge out of necessity. Competition is moderate among the few established shops, which helps maintain reasonable pricing. Typical labor rates in this area range from $90 to $120 per hour, which is generally lower than in major metropolitan areas. Service quality is often high, as these businesses rely heavily on community reputation and word-of-mouth. For highly specialized services like advanced MyLink diagnostics or Corvette-specific performance work, residents of Gate may need to travel to larger hubs like Woodward or even Amarillo, Texas.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about chevrolet repair services in Gate, OK

What are the most common Chevrolet repair issues for vehicles in the Gate, Oklahoma area?

Given the rural roads and potential for dusty conditions around Gate, common issues include premature wear on suspension components, air filter and cabin filter clogging, and cooling system concerns due to temperature fluctuations. For specific models like the Silverado, technicians often address 4WD system maintenance and exhaust leaks.

How can I find a reputable and trustworthy Chevrolet repair shop near Gate?

Look for shops in Gate or nearby towns like Buffalo or Laverne that employ ASE-certified technicians with specific GM/Chevrolet training. Check online reviews and ask local farmers or ranchers for personal recommendations, as word-of-mouth is strong in our community for identifying honest, skilled mechanics.

Are repair costs for Chevrolets higher in rural areas like Gate compared to larger cities?

Labor rates in Gate may be slightly lower than in major metro areas, but parts availability can sometimes influence cost and timeline. For specialized parts, a local shop may need to order them, which can add a day for shipping, but a good shop will communicate this clearly upfront.

When should I seek service for my Chevrolet's 4WD system given the local driving conditions?

You should have the 4WD system serviced and tested annually, ideally before winter or the spring rainy season when county roads around Gate can become muddy or rough. Unusual noises when engaging 4WD or warning lights are immediate signs to seek service at a local shop familiar with these systems.

What local factors should I consider for maintaining my Chevrolet in Gate's climate?

The high winds and dust in the Oklahoma Panhandle necessitate more frequent air filter changes and exterior washes to protect paint. Also, prepare your cooling system and battery for both hot summers and cold winters, as temperature extremes are common and can strain these components.
